Antarmuka IMFMediaEngineEx (mfmediaengine.h)
Memperluas antarmuka IMFMediaEngine .
Warisan
Antarmuka IMFMediaEngineEx mewarisi dari IMFMediaEngine. IMFMediaEngineEx juga memiliki jenis anggota berikut:
Metode
Antarmuka IMFMediaEngineEx memiliki metode ini.
IMFMediaEngineEx::ApplyStreamSelections Menerapkan pilihan aliran dari panggilan sebelumnya ke SetStreamSelection. |
IMFMediaEngineEx::CancelTimelineMarkerTimer Membatalkan penanda garis waktu tertunda berikutnya. |
IMFMediaEngineEx::EnableHorizontalMirrorMode Mengaktifkan atau menonaktifkan pencerminan video. |
IMFMediaEngineEx::EnableTimeUpdateTimer Mengaktifkan atau menonaktifkan timer pembaruan waktu. |
IMFMediaEngineEx::EnableWindowlessSwapchainMode Mengaktifkan atau menonaktifkan mode rantai swap tanpa jendela. |
IMFMediaEngineEx::FrameStep Langkah-langkah maju atau mundur satu bingkai. |
IMFMediaEngineEx::GetAudioEndpointRole Mendapatkan peran titik akhir perangkat audio yang digunakan untuk panggilan berikutnya ke SetSource atau Load. |
IMFMediaEngineEx::GetAudioStreamCategory Mendapatkan kategori aliran audio yang digunakan untuk panggilan berikutnya ke SetSource atau Load. |
IMFMediaEngineEx::GetBalance Mendapatkan keseimbangan audio. |
IMFMediaEngineEx::GetNumberOfStreams Mendapatkan jumlah aliran di sumber daya media. |
IMFMediaEngineEx::GetPresentationAttribute Mendapatkan atribut presentasi dari sumber daya media. |
IMFMediaEngineEx::GetRealTimeMode Mendapatkan mode real time yang digunakan untuk panggilan berikutnya ke SetSource atau Load. |
IMFMediaEngineEx::GetResourceCharacteristics Mendapatkan berbagai bendera yang menjelaskan sumber daya media. |
IMFMediaEngineEx::GetStatistics Mendapatkan statistik pemutaran dari Mesin Media. |
IMFMediaEngineEx::GetStereo3DFramePackingMode Untuk video 3D stereoskopis, mendapatkan tata letak dua tampilan dalam bingkai video. |
IMFMediaEngineEx::GetStereo3DRenderMode Untuk video 3D stereoskopis, kueri bagaimana Media Engine merender konten video 3D. |
IMFMediaEngineEx::GetStreamAttribute Mendapatkan atribut tingkat aliran dari sumber daya media. |
IMFMediaEngineEx::GetStreamSelection Kueri apakah aliran dipilih untuk diputar. (IMFMediaEngineEx.GetStreamSelection) |
IMFMediaEngineEx::GetTimelineMarkerTimer Mendapatkan waktu penanda garis waktu berikutnya, jika ada. |
IMFMediaEngineEx::GetVideoSwapchainHandle Mendapatkan handel ke rantai pertukaran tanpa jendela. |
IMFMediaEngineEx::InsertAudioEffect Menyisipkan efek audio. |
IMFMediaEngineEx::InsertVideoEffect Menyisipkan efek video. |
IMFMediaEngineEx::IsPlaybackRateSupported Mengkueri apakah Mesin Media dapat diputar pada laju pemutaran tertentu. |
IMFMediaEngineEx::IsProtected Kueri apakah sumber daya media berisi konten yang dilindungi. |
IMFMediaEngineEx::IsStereo3D Mengkueri apakah sumber daya media berisi video 3D stereoskopis. |
IMFMediaEngineEx::RemoveAllEffects Menghapus semua efek audio dan video. |
IMFMediaEngineEx::SetAudioEndpointRole Mengatur titik akhir perangkat audio yang digunakan untuk panggilan berikutnya ke SetSource atau Load. |
IMFMediaEngineEx::SetAudioStreamCategory Mengatur kategori aliran audio untuk panggilan berikutnya ke SetSource atau Load. |
IMFMediaEngineEx::SetBalance Mengatur keseimbangan audio. (IMFMediaEngineEx.SetBalance) |
IMFMediaEngineEx::SetCurrentTimeEx Mencari posisi pemutaran baru menggunakan MF_MEDIA_ENGINE_SEEK_MODE yang ditentukan. |
IMFMediaEngineEx::SetRealTimeMode Mengatur mode real time yang digunakan untuk panggilan berikutnya ke SetSource atau Load. |
IMFMediaEngineEx::SetSourceFromByteStream Membuka sumber daya media dari aliran byte. |
IMFMediaEngineEx::SetStereo3DFramePackingMode Untuk video 3D stereoskopis, mengatur tata letak dua tampilan dalam bingkai video. |
IMFMediaEngineEx::SetStereo3DRenderMode Untuk video 3D stereoskopis, menentukan bagaimana Mesin Media merender konten video 3D. |
IMFMediaEngineEx::SetStreamSelection Memilih atau membatalkan pilihan streaming untuk pemutaran. |
IMFMediaEngineEx::SetTimelineMarkerTimer Menentukan waktu presentasi ketika Mesin Media akan mengirim peristiwa penanda. |
IMFMediaEngineEx::UpdateVideoStream Updates persegi panjang sumber, persegi panjang tujuan, dan warna batas untuk video. |
Keterangan
Antarmuka IMFMediaEngine berisi metode yang memetakan ke elemen media HTML5. IMFMediaEngineEx menyediakan fungsionalitas tambahan yang tidak sesuai langsung dengan HTML5.
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ows 8 [aplikasi desktop | Aplikasi UWP] |
Server minimum yang didukung | Windows Server 2012 [aplikasi desktop | Aplikasi UWP] |
Target Platform | Windows |
Header | mfmediaengine.h |
Lihat juga
Saran dan Komentar
https://aka.ms/ContentUserFeedback.
Segera hadir: Sepanjang tahun 2024 kami akan menghentikan penggunaan GitHub Issues sebagai mekanisme umpan balik untuk konten dan menggantinya dengan sistem umpan balik baru. Untuk mengetahui informasi selengkapnya, lihat:Kirim dan lihat umpan balik untuk